Healthcare’s Diagnostic Leap and Personalized Medicine

In healthcare, intelligent systems are revolutionizing everything from drug discovery to patient diagnostics. AI-powered tools can analyze vast amounts of medical data—patient histories, genetic information, imaging results—to identify patterns and predict disease onset with remarkable accuracy. This leads to earlier intervention, more personalized treatment plans, and a significant reduction in diagnostic errors. Surgical robots guided by AI enhance precision, while machine learning accelerates the identification of potential drug candidates, drastically cutting down research and development timelines.

Manufacturing and Supply Chain Optimization

For the manufacturing sector, AI brings an unprecedented level of efficiency and resilience. Predictive maintenance algorithms analyze sensor data from machinery to anticipate failures before they occur, minimizing downtime and maintenance costs. Robotic process automation (RPA) streamlines repetitive tasks, freeing human workers for more complex roles. Furthermore, AI-driven supply chain management systems can forecast demand, optimize logistics, and respond dynamically to disruptions, ensuring smoother operations even in volatile global markets.

Financial Services: Enhanced Security and Insights

The financial industry benefits immensely from intelligent systems in fraud detection, algorithmic trading, and personalized customer service. AI algorithms can detect anomalous transactions in real-time, thwarting fraudulent activities. In trading, AI analyzes market trends and executes trades at optimal moments, often outperforming human traders. Chatbots and virtual assistants powered by natural language processing provide 24/7 customer support, handling inquiries and offering personalized financial advice.
